当前位置:编程学习 > VB >>

检索问题, 大家帮帮忙吧!!!!

MD17-1136 (17)秦皇岛市抚宁县保康医药商场 MD 17 Y
MD17-1137 (17)秦皇岛市抚宁县金山药店 MD 17 Y
FD17-0660 (17)秦皇岛市抚宁县康美大药店 FD 17 Y
MD17-1126 (17)秦皇岛市抚宁县丽东药房 MD 17 Y
MD17-1127 (17)秦皇岛市抚宁县天马大药房 MD 17 Y
MD17-1115 (17)秦皇岛市抚宁县益生药店 MD 17 Y
DS01-1919 (17)秦皇岛市海港区路康药店 DS 01 Y
MD17-1124 (17)秦皇岛市海港区同一堂药店 MD 17 Y
MD17-1117 (17)秦皇岛市同健药店 MD 17 Y

在EXECL里面的一张表中,有这些列,现在遇到的问题是:
第二列中有秦皇岛这个市,当选中秦皇岛这三个字后,在另外一个空白列中显示他所在的省份。
这张表数据很大,急求解答! 检索 --------------------编程问答-------------------- replace("秦皇岛","河北省秦皇岛")

没有第二个秦皇岛了吧, 难道还用得着做查询么? 直接写上去即可 --------------------编程问答--------------------

引用 1 楼 WallesCai 的回复:
replace("秦皇岛","河北省秦皇岛")

没有第二个秦皇岛了吧, 难道还用得着做查询么? 直接写上去即可



有好多数据,难道都得这样一个一个写吗? --------------------编程问答--------------------
引用 2 楼 zxmcsnd 的回复:
引用 1 楼 WallesCai 的回复:replace("秦皇岛","河北省秦皇岛")

没有第二个秦皇岛了吧, 难道还用得着做查询么? 直接写上去即可


有好多数据,难道都得这样一个一个写吗?


那就是说还有其他市,并且还有一个表有市=>省的所属关系咯?
你先得把这个"市"的关键词给提取出来(假设你每条记录中的城市名后面都有一个"市"字的话会比较容易)将提取到的市单独列在后面的某一列中.
然后根据这一列的内容去后面查表.
可以按照这个思路尝试先作一个宏, 参考一下宏代码吧.
--------------------编程问答-------------------- 加个QQ吧,我给你张表你看看。 --------------------编程问答--------------------
引用 1 楼 WallesCai 的回复:
replace("秦皇岛","河北省秦皇岛")

没有第二个秦皇岛了吧, 难道还用得着做查询么? 直接写上去即可



我给你个表你看看:我Q 1034677692 --------------------编程问答--------------------
引用 5 楼 zxmcsnd 的回复:
引用 1 楼 WallesCai 的回复:replace("秦皇岛","河北省秦皇岛")

没有第二个秦皇岛了吧, 难道还用得着做查询么? 直接写上去即可


我给你个表你看看:我Q 1034677692


.....兄弟, 表酱紫好不好, 咱上有老下有小的. 快下了班,回到家都忙得没时间开电脑的, 改天好不好?  或者你发CSDN资源里面, 我去下载,有空帮你看? --------------------编程问答--------------------
引用 6 楼 WallesCai 的回复:
引用 5 楼 zxmcsnd 的回复:
引用 1 楼 WallesCai 的回复:replace("秦皇岛","河北省秦皇岛")

没有第二个秦皇岛了吧, 难道还用得着做查询么? 直接写上去即可


我给你个表你看看:我Q 1034677692

.....兄弟, 表酱紫好不好, 咱上有老下有小的. 快下了班,回到家都忙得没时间开电脑的, 改天好不好?  或者你发CSDN资源里面,……




好吧,改天在打扰你吧- -
补充:VB ,  VBA
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,